Two patches were proposed in this bug report, and this patch (looking quite similar) was applied a month later. commit 0a5cfeeecb9e1038f9df3b34b61b797e56213a7b Author: Stefan Monnier AuthorDate: Tue May 20 16:12:30 2014 -0400 * lisp/progmodes/scheme.el (scheme-mode-syntax-table): Remove hack for #; comments. (scheme-syntax-propertize, scheme-syntax-propertize-sexp-comment): New functions. (scheme-mode-variables): Set syntax-propertize-function instead of font-lock-syntactic-face-function. (scheme-font-lock-syntactic-face-function): Delete. However, the original test case still fails: > Consider the following line of Scheme code: > > (foo bar #;(baz (quux #;() zot) mumble) frotz) > > If the point is at the beginning, hitting C-M-f causes Emacs to barf > on imbalanced parentheses. (Or perhaps it fails again?) At least, in Emacs 28, putting that into /tmp/foo.sch and hitting `C-M-f' gives me an error. -- (domestic pets only, the antidote for overdose, milk.) bloggy blog: http://lars.ingebrigtsen.no
